Contoh Menguraikan Tugas
Untuk menghitung tugas, Anda harus memanggil ITaskScheduler::Enum untuk membuat objek enumerasi . Kemudian, gunakan antarmuka IEnumWorkItems objek enumerasi untuk menghitung tugas di folder Tugas Terjadwal.
Prosedur berikut ini menjelaskan cara menghitung tugas di folder Tugas Terjadwal.
Untuk menghitung tugas di folder Tugas Terjadwal
- Panggil CoInitialize untuk menginisialisasi pustaka COM dan CoCreateInstance untuk mendapatkan objek Task Scheduler. (Contoh ini mengasumsikan bahwa layanan Penjadwal Tugas sedang berjalan.)
- Panggil ITaskScheduler::Enum untuk mendapatkan objek enumerasi.
- Panggil IEnumWorkItems::Next untuk mengambil tugas. (Contoh ini mencoba mendapatkan lima tugas setiap kali pemanggilan.)
- Memproses tugas yang telah dikembalikan. (Contoh ini hanya mencetak nama setiap tugas ke layar.
- Lepaskan sumber daya. Panggil CoTaskMemFree untuk membebaskan memori yang digunakan untuk nama.
Untuk contoh kode | Lihat |
---|---|
Menghitung semua tugas di folder Tugas Terjadwal komputer lokal | Contoh Kode C/C++: Menghitung Tugas |
Topik terkait